13 references to Regular
Microsoft.CodeAnalysis (9)
Operations\ControlFlowGraphBuilder.cs (9)
326
case ControlFlowBranchSemantics.
Regular
:
705
Debug.Assert(predecessor.FallThrough.Kind == ControlFlowBranchSemantics.
Regular
);
828
Debug.Assert(next.Kind == ControlFlowBranchSemantics.
Regular
||
949
Debug.Assert(next.Kind == ControlFlowBranchSemantics.
Regular
||
1097
Debug.Assert(predecessorBranch.Kind == ControlFlowBranchSemantics.
Regular
);
1226
Debug.Assert(branch.Kind == ControlFlowBranchSemantics.
Regular
);
1368
private static void LinkBlocks(BasicBlockBuilder prevBlock, BasicBlockBuilder nextBlock, ControlFlowBranchSemantics branchKind = ControlFlowBranchSemantics.
Regular
)
3285
return new BasicBlockBuilder.Branch() { Destination = destination, Kind = ControlFlowBranchSemantics.
Regular
};
3841
LinkBlocks(CurrentBasicBlock, _exit, returnedValue is null ? ControlFlowBranchSemantics.
Regular
: ControlFlowBranchSemantics.Return);
Microsoft.CodeAnalysis.CodeStyle (1)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\FlowAnalysis\CustomDataFlowAnalysis.cs (1)
225
case ControlFlowBranchSemantics.
Regular
:
Microsoft.CodeAnalysis.Test.Utilities (2)
Compilation\ControlFlowGraphVerifier.cs (1)
1582
Assert.True(ControlFlowBranchSemantics.
Regular
== branch.Semantics || ControlFlowBranchSemantics.Return == branch.Semantics);
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\FlowAnalysis\CustomDataFlowAnalysis.cs (1)
225
case ControlFlowBranchSemantics.
Regular
:
Microsoft.CodeAnalysis.Workspaces (1)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\FlowAnalysis\CustomDataFlowAnalysis.cs (1)
225
case ControlFlowBranchSemantics.
Regular
: